Tesco own brand spice/herb jars have PP5 lids and are rectangular so can be laid on one side for agar to spread out more, there is a tight enough neck on the jar so when laid flat it is not spilling out. The lids are handy to use too, they flip up and there is a small hole, no unscrewing needed if just dropping stuff in. Some of the lids do not say PP on them but they more than likely are. PP is generally used on items with a "living hinge", the non stamped lids have the same feel as the others too.

I made test jars of PF substrate in cow & gate babyfood jars. The caps & threads are a bit odd on them, very little thread and difficult enough to screw on correctly as they end up slanted. I had about 5 with other jars all loosely capped and when cooled in a PC they did not seal themselves like many do (which I do not like), I think due to the thread design they would not seal themselves. So I can leave the lids intact and let them cool naturally in the PC and not have to worry about them creating a vacuum in the jar (sucking in air when opened later and making them difficult to open).
They are usually on offer if you buy several, it would not cross peoples minds as they may have no babies! also they are not in the regular food aisles so you do not even see them. Also most would not think they would possible eat baby food, but I was just getting fruit puree ones and adding it to a smoothie or mixing it into natural yogurt, they do have some rice flour in them but it is minimal and mostly just fruit.
Mine were 125g jars. I see the 200g and 125g jars are 8 for £4 in tesco. They could be OK for agar though a bit hard to get into, esp. if you got the taller 200g ones.
Small empty jars like these often would cost more, so even if you were to dump it you would possibly save. You often have to buy huge amounts before it would become cheaper per jar.
